Datacenter Sites in Linn County, Kansas
Linn County has 22 scored datacenter candidate sites averaging 55.3/100 DC Readiness, with a catalogued aggregate of 6,300 MW. FEMA rates local natural-hazard risk as "Relatively High". The county has a datacenter tax incentive on record.

Incentive detail: PEAK program payroll tax incentives; IRB property tax exemptions available.
